About the Commission
The planning commission may consist of no less than 12 members, appointed by the mayor and confirmed by a council majority vote. Ex-officio members include the board of supervisors of the county, the city engineer, the county engineer, the city building official, the manager of Greenwood Utilities, and a representative of the Greenwood-Leflore County Industrial Board.

Members serve three-year terms. Terms expire January 1.

Meeting Information
Meetings held the fourth Thursday of each month at 4:30 pm on call.
Planning Commission Review
To bring a matter to the attention of the Planning Commission, please fill out this application and deliver it (along with supporting documents and a $101 filing fee) to the Community Development office 19 days prior to the next meeting.
